Download from Good Luck To You Leo Grande (2023) Org Hindi Dubbed Movie Blueray Hd 720p.mp4 Download in DownloadHub
download free Good Luck To You Leo Grande (2023) ORG Hindi Dubbed Movie from good luck to you leo grande (2023) org hindi dubbed movie blueray hd 720p.mp4